Why Your Neighbor’s Solar Battery Price Isn’t Yours

Ever wondered why two identical homes in California might pay $8,000 vs. $15,000 for similar solar storage? The home solar battery price isn’t just about hardware—it’s a maze of local incentives, installation quirks, and what I call “climate math.”

Let’s break it down: A 10kWh system in Texas averages $12,750 before incentives. But cross into Arizona, and suddenly you’re looking at $14,200. Why the $1,450 jump? Blame humidity tolerance specs and mandatory grid-connection fees that vary by ZIP code.

The Silent Budget Killers

You’ve probably heard the sales pitch: “$10k for a Tesla Powerwall!” Sounds neat, right? Wait, no—that’s not the whole story. Add:

  • Permit fees ($300-$1,800)
  • Electrical upgrades (old panels? That’ll cost ya)
  • Wall reinforcement (batteries aren’t featherweights)

Suddenly your solar battery costs balloon by 23%. I’ve seen homeowners in Florida get stung by hurricane-proof mounting requirements that added $2,100 overnight. Ouch.

Bavaria’s Battery Revolution: A Blueprint

Germany’s residential storage costs plunged from €1,600/kWh in 2016 to €900/kWh today. How? Three game-changers:

  1. Group-buy programs (20+ homes = 18% discount)
  2. Standardized installation templates
  3. Tax breaks for recycled battery components

Munich resident Klaus Weber slashed his home energy storage price by partnering with neighbors. “We bought 35 systems collectively—saved enough to fund a community EV charger,” he told me last month.

The Lithium Rollercoaster

Lithium carbonate prices dropped 60% in 2023… then spiked 22% this April. What gives? Electric vehicle demand in China’s choking battery supply chains. But here’s the kicker: New sodium-ion batteries entering the market could stabilize residential solar battery prices by 2025.

Imagine this: You’re choosing between a $13k lithium setup and a $9k sodium alternative. Both store 12kWh. Which would you pick? Manufacturers are betting your wallet will decide.

Your Burning Questions Answered

Q: Do cheaper batteries compromise safety?

A: Not necessarily—look for UL 9540 certification. Quality isn’t always price-tagged.

Q: How soon will I break even?

A: In sunny states like Nevada, 6-8 years. Cloudy regions? Maybe 10-12.

Q: Are there secret incentives?

A: Some utilities offer “demand response” payments—PG&E pays $750/year to access your stored power during peak times.
